Are people in Pacific older or younger than people in Yakima?
- The Median Age in Pacific is 2.0 years younger than in Yakima.

Are housing costs cheaper in Pacific or Yakima?
- Pacific housing costs are 59.0% more expensive than Yakima hous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Pacific or Yakima?
- The average commute for residents of Pacific is 12.0 minutes longer than it is for residents of Yakima.
